Understanding Scurvy: A Historic and Modern Perspective

Scurvy has a long and infamous history, primarily associated with sailors during the Age of Exploration who spent months or years at sea without access to fresh produce. While many consider it a disease of the past, it continues to appear in modern times, particularly among vulnerable populations with poor nutritional habits. The root cause is a severe deficiency of vitamin C, also known as ascorbic acid, which the human body cannot produce on its own. This makes a regular, sufficient dietary intake of vitamin C an absolute necessity for health.

The Critical Role of Vitamin C

Vitamin C is a water-soluble vitamin that plays a vital role in numerous bodily functions. Its most critical role in relation to scurvy is as a cofactor for enzymes essential for synthesizing collagen. Collagen is the most abundant protein in the body, forming the structural framework of connective tissues, skin, blood vessels, cartilage, and bones. Without adequate vitamin C, collagen production is impaired, leading to a breakdown of these tissues and the widespread symptoms characteristic of scurvy. The vitamin also protects cells from free radical damage and supports immune function.

The Diet Lacking Vitamin C

For a person to develop scurvy, they must maintain a diet severely lacking in vitamin C for an extended period. A primary cause is a lack of fresh fruits and vegetables. Individuals consuming a diet of processed or pre-packaged foods are particularly vulnerable. Historically, this meant sailors at sea, and today, it includes those with restrictive diets or limited access to fresh produce. Vitamin C is heat-sensitive, and cooking can reduce its content in foods.

Who is at Risk for Scurvy?

While rare in many modern societies, scurvy can affect specific groups. Those at risk often include individuals with poor dietary habits, those struggling with alcohol or drug dependency, or those with eating disorders. Low socioeconomic status and certain chronic illnesses can also increase risk. Additionally, infants fed unsupplemented milk, smokers, and pregnant or breastfeeding women may have increased vulnerability or requirements.

Symptoms and Complications of Scurvy

The symptoms of scurvy develop gradually. Progression occurs if left untreated.

Early and Advanced Symptoms

Early symptoms can include fatigue and muscle aches. Advanced symptoms include swollen, bleeding gums, skin hemorrhages, dry hair, impaired wound healing, and musculoskeletal pain.

Comparing Early vs. Advanced Scurvy Symptoms

Symptom Category Early Scurvy Advanced Scurvy
General Fatigue, weakness, malaise Profound weakness, lethargy, significant weight loss
Oral/Dental Minor gum sensitivity or discomfort Swollen, bleeding gums; loose teeth; possible tooth loss
Skin Easy bruising, subtle petechiae Widespread bruising, perifollicular hemorrhages, corkscrew hairs
Musculoskeletal Vague muscle and joint aches Severe joint pain, swelling, potential hemorrhages
Healing Slow wound recovery Reopening of old wounds, very poor healing

Prevention and Treatment: A Practical Guide

Scurvy is preventable and treatable with proper nutrition. Prevention involves consistent intake of vitamin C-rich foods, and treatment requires replenishing levels.

Prevention Through Diet

A balanced diet rich in fruits and vegetables prevents scurvy. Sources include citrus fruits, berries, and peppers. Eating these raw or lightly cooked preserves vitamin C.

The Path to Recovery
